API für verfügbare Benutzende
Letzte Aktualisierung: 31. Dezember 2024
Erstellt für:
- Entwickler
URI: attask/api/v15.0/user/getUsersAvailableTime
Der Endpunkt für die verfügbare Zeit des Benutzers ruft Daten zur verfügbaren Zeit des Benutzers ab. Dies ermöglicht Integrationen für die Aggregation von Daten anhand von Benutzerattributen und Zeitintervallen.
Beispielanfrage
curl -XPUT /attask/api/v15.0/user/getUsersAvailableTime
Anfrageparameter
-
userIDs: Array von Zeichenfolgen. Erforderlich. Beispiel:
"61a9cc0500002f9fdaa7a6f824f557e1"
. -
fromDate: datetime. Zeichenfolge. Erforderlich. Beispiel:
"2022-07-10T00:00:00"
. -
toDate: datetime. Zeichenfolge. Erforderlich. Beispiel
"2022-07-20T23:59:59"
.
Beispielantwort:
{
"data": {
"result": {
"PAVL": {
"61a9cc0500002f9fdaa7a6f824f557e1": [
0.0,
480.0,
480.0,
480.0,
480.0,
480.0,
0.0,
0.0,
480.0,
480.0,
480.0
]
},
"AVL": {
"61a9cc0500002f9fdaa7a6f824f557e1": [
0.0,
480.0,
480.0,
480.0,
480.0,
0.0,
480.0,
0.0,
480.0,
480.0,
480.0
]
}
}
}
}
Antwortparameter
- AVL: Tatsächlich verfügbare Stunden. Array von Zahlen.
- PAVL: Reine verfügbare Stunden für die Planung, die keine arbeitsfreien Tage oder Ausfallzeiten von Benutzenden beinhalten. Zeichenfolge.
recommendation-more-help
5f00cc6b-2202-40d6-bcd0-3ee0c2316b43